Hey TRahul,
thanks for ur interest in St Gallen.
Indians are a competitive breed.. almost all of them are based in and around Zurich.

I understand that the job placement scenario at indian B-schools is quite different and i have addressed these points specifically in the post http://mba-hsg.blogspot.com/2007/11/jobs-b-schools-to-business-practice.html

About the language.. a good grip on the german language is very beneficial in terms of broadening ur scope of job opportunities .. however, switzerland also has one of the most international companies.. so u should find a decent job nevertheless! Also, the german language requirement varies from company to company.. i have discussed this issue to some extent in this post http://mba-hsg.blogspot.com/2007/12/block-ii-opportunities-galore.html

and finding a good job is also a question of fit.. and own efforts..

Hi

St Gallen is a great school with the best reputation in the german-speaking areas in the world. The MBA programme is new, however, it is a very good programme.

But as a non-European who want to look for a job in Europe, it is generally difficult but it's not impossible. You are going to learn a lot more also compare to study in India back.
